文档介绍:soc实验报告一、实验目的1、了解soc系统的结构和基本内容;2、了解fpga基本工作原理和内容;3、了解fpga的基本开发过程4、学会使用xilinxise软件进行设计、仿真、综合、下载调试;5、熟悉fpga设计实验的软硬件环境,加深对polestar实验版的认识,为后面的实验的学习做好准备。二、实验设备pc主机、xilinxise开发软件、polestar实验平台三、实验原理1、soc嵌入式soc:是指在嵌入式系统中广泛应用的,有专门应用范围的soc芯片,是在单个芯片上集成一个完整的系统,对所有或部分必要的电子电路进行包分组的技术。所谓完整的系统一般包括中央处理器、存储器、以及外围电路等。具体地说,soc设计的关键技术主要包括总线架构技术、ip核可复用技术、软硬件协同设计技术、soc验证技术、可测性设计技术、低功耗设计技术、超深亚微米电路实现技术等,此外还要做嵌入式软件移植、开发研究,是一门跨学科的新兴研究领域。2、fpgafpga(field-programmablegatearray),即现场可编程门阵列,它是在pal、gal、cpld等可编程器件的基础上进一步发展的产物。它是作为专用集成电路(asic)领域中的一种半定制电路而出现的,既解决了定制电路的不足,又克服了原有可编程器件门电路数有限的缺点。fpga具有以下特点:1)采用fpga设计asic电路(特定用途集成电路),用户不需要投片生产,就能得到合用的芯片。2)fpga可做其它全定制或半定制asic电路的中试样片。3)fpga内部有丰富的触发器和i/o引脚。4)fpga是asic电路中设计周期最短、开发费用最低、风险最小的器件之一。5)fpga采用高速chmos工艺,功耗低,可以与cmos、ttl电平兼容。可以说,fpga芯片是小批量系统提高系统集成度、可靠性的最佳选择之一。fpga是由存放在片内ram中的程序来设置其工作状态的,因此,工作时需要对片内的ram进行编程。用户可以根据不同的配置模式,采用不同的编程方式。3、fpga的简单开发流程1)、需求分析到模块划分需求说明文档器件选择:逻辑资源,功耗,i/o数量,封装等配置电路考虑开发工具选择电路板的可扩展性考虑在线调试和班级天使考虑分模块的设计2)、设计输入到综合优化设计输入:原理图/verilog/vhdl综合:是指将较高层次的电路描述转化为较低层次的电路描述。3)、实现到时序收敛实现:翻译——将综合后的结果转化成所选器件的底层模块和硬件原语映射——将翻译的结果映射到具体器件上布局布线——根据用户的设计约束,进行布局布线,完成fpga内部逻辑的连接时序收敛:工具的最终布局布线结果满足设计者输入的时序约束要求4)仿真测试到版级调试四、实验步骤1、建立project2、veriloghdl语言的输入3、xst综合设计4、建立ucf用户约束文件5、建立下载配置文件下载调试6、在virtex2pro上找到switch开关sw9,开关1置on,开关2置0,之后按reset键2秒后fpga芯片就完成了从prom读取设计。五、实验结果与分析实验板下载配置好之后,观察实验结果。实验结果和预期完全相同。篇二:岩土测试技术读书报告课程读书报告岩土测试技术报告人:班级:学号:学院:2014年5月第一章绪论基本概念岩土工程是欧美国家于20世纪60年代在土木工程实践中建立起来的一种新的技术体制。岩土工程是以求解岩体与土体工程问题,包括地基与基础、边坡和地下工程等问题,作为自己的研究对象。岩土工程专业是土木工程的分支,是运用工程地质学、土力学、岩石力学解决各类工程中关于岩石、土的工程技术问题的科学。按照工程建设阶段划分,工作内容可以分为:岩土工程勘察、岩土工程设计、岩土工程治理、岩土工程监测、岩土工程检测。随着我国经济的繁荣与发展,各种建筑工程如雨后春笋般拔地而起,座座水库波光粼粼,栋栋高楼鳞次栉比。在各种土建工程中,岩土工程占有十分重要的地位。岩土工程是以土力学、岩体力学及工程地质学为理论基础,运用各种勘探测试技术对岩土体进行综合整治改造和利用而进行的系统性工作。这一学科在国外某些国家和地区被称为“大地工程”、“土力工程”或“土质工程”。岩土工程是土木工程的一个重要组成部分。智研咨询资料统计,它包括岩土工程勘察、设计、试验、施工和监测,涉及工程建设的全过程。在房屋、市政、能源、水利、道路、航运、矿山、国防等各种建设中,都有十分重要的意义。主要研究方向①城市地下空间与地下工程:以城市地下空间为主体,研究地下空间开发利用过程中的各种环境岩土工程问题,地下空间资源的合理利用策略,以及各类地下结构的设计、计算方法和地下工程的施工技术(如浅埋暗挖、盾构法、冻结法、降水排水法、沉管法、tbm法等)及其优化措施等等。②边坡与基坑工程:重点研究基坑